Transaction 523e03741203fe3c731e3005fe99129092347b571be0fe75c2336df2a5e8110e

1 Input
2 Outputs
  • 523e03741203fe3c731e3005fe99129092347b571be0fe75c2336df2a5e8110e:0
  • value  814770
    address  1MLFm4XsyCYTVReWxmZuyQoGnZre7oYLyP
  • 523e03741203fe3c731e3005fe99129092347b571be0fe75c2336df2a5e8110e:1
  • value  128617790
    address  38HemiL4SgG4PK6vtRU4d4vaYUpPhEyjAx